                        Good one -

                        Give him loads of horsepower and tires that will withstand good abuse, and no matter what the chassis is or the forks are, he will thrash everyone out there.

                        Put him on a nice friendly bike that requires delicate handling, patience, race craft, and such assorted subtle nuances for which Casey gives no shit, he will have a trouble some year. Not denying he will be fast - he will do well, but we won't see the real Casey. Lorenzo on a similar bike might have the edge over him, just like Pedrosa had a slight edge once the Honda was sorted.

                        In other words, put the entire grid on the same ill mannered bike with loads of horsepower and tons of unrideable character: Casey will thrash everyone else and probably win every race.

                        On the other hand, put the entire grid on a bike like the Yamaha: Casey will find himself at a disadvantage; a Lorenzo or a younger Rossi might win a closely fought championship.

                                Not very surprising.

                                The Honda's have gone quicker as expected. Lorenzo crashed, so he was slow. Don't get shocked to see Marquez at the top anymore. Rossi was back to testing race pace, yet he was very fast.

                                The biggest shocker of the session was Hayden pulling out a single fast lap to put his bike in 2nd just .063 seconds adrift of Marquez.
